Output d544b75a7ae1dc3ebcd6232efaab883cc4fa741fa06edddb389ca0a2b3638558:0

value
42573459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4307b0e842a9a11e87b8610edc31f37653975938 OP_EQUAL
address
37oSQnAV8DbAdEMb3d4wvxTRSuSYfBGWqr
transaction
d544b75a7ae1dc3ebcd6232efaab883cc4fa741fa06edddb389ca0a2b3638558
confirmations
379056
spent
true